
Since 2012, AuctionMethod has provided white-label auction software and custom auction software development for the auction industry. Based in Massachusetts, serving the U.S., Canada, Australia, and New Zealand. AuctionMethod serves auctioneers, estate liquidators, farm and heavy equipment, industrial, salvage and recycling, non-profit, corporations, retail liquidators, auto/car dealers, real estate, arts and collectibles, and single-use auction businesses.
AuctionMethod is the winner of the SourceForge Spring 2026 Top Performer Award in Auction Software, and is rated 4.9/5 on Capterra and SourceForge. AuctionMethod's model includes no commissions, no per-lot fees, no platform skim, and no contract, so clients keep the revenue from every sale instead of splitting it with the platform. Clients also keep 100% ownership of their bidder lists, seller lists, item data, images, and transaction history on a fully white-label auction website rather than a shared marketplace listing.
The platform covers catalog and lot management, consignor setup, bidder registration, invoicing, payment processing, tax handling, and reporting in one system. Auction event types include timed online auctions, simulcast auctions, blind timed auctions, catalog-only, fixed-price, and perpetual events. AuctionMethod includes a mobile app for iOS and Android and integrates with Fiserv, Stripe, Authorize.net, and more.
Hosted on AWS with separate client databases, AuctionMethod specializes in real-time speed for live, rapid-fire simulcast auctions, where latency is critical and must stay under one second so online bidders do not miss the auctioneer's hammer, and the platform is fully hosted with daily backups, auto-scaling for high traffic, and security updates included, with 100% uptime tracked on a public status page.
For operations whose workflows fall outside the standard product, AuctionMethod also builds custom auction software development solutions, a dedicated codebase built around a client's specific processes, quoted at a fixed rate. AuctionMethod's pricing starts at $100/mo with a $250 one-time setup charge, and is published publicly. AuctionMethod offers a 30-day free trial, no credit card required.

CHARMS is a secure, online case management system used to manage all aspects of record keeping for foster care, adoption, children residential, supported accommodation, residential family centres, foster carer recruitment hubs, adult shared lives (adult foster care), supported employment and other care services.
SCN is a not-for-profit organisation, and always will be privately owned. It follows the principles of sociocracy so that all staff and customers are part of the CHARMS community and its development and progress. It means that everyone - employees, customers, suppliers and, most importantly, users of CHARMS - have a say in what CHARMS does and what it needs to do. We strive to ensure that care staff, educators, social workers, support staff and others who deliver care and education, can get on with the job knowing that CHARMS looks after their important, sensitive information.

HappyHorse 1.1
HappyHorse-1.1-T2V is a text-to-video generation model available through QwenCloud. The model turns text prompts into video output with improved semantic understanding, cinematic shot control, and dynamic motion rendering. HappyHorse-1.1-T2V is designed to capture creative intent more accurately while producing videos with smoother motion, richer details, and stronger visual consistency. It supports natural character actions, scene atmosphere, and physical dynamics for more realistic video generation. The model can be accessed through the QwenCloud API with configurable options such as resolution, aspect ratio, and duration. Built for developers, creators, and AI product teams, HappyHorse-1.1-T2V helps generate high-quality videos from text prompts at scale.
